Tropican High Performance Formula is a premium extruded daily diet specially formulated for weaning, fledgling, breeding, and active parrots that require higher caloric nutrition. Made with a delicious blend of eight grains, peanuts, and natural fruit flavors including orange and banana, this highly palatable formula delivers complete daily nutrition while supporting feather condition, muscle development, reproductive health, and overall wellbeing. Enriched with essential vitamins, minerals, prebiotic fibre, and natural Omega fatty acids, Tropican eliminates the need for additional vitamin supplements when fed as the primary diet.

Specifications

Product Type Complete Extruded Daily Diet for Parrots
Food Format Extruded Granules
Suitable Life Stages Weaning, Fledgling, Adult, Breeding, Molting and Active Parrots
Recommended For Cockatiels, Conures, Lovebirds, Quakers and Ringnecks
Main Benefits Daily nutrition, feather condition, breeding support, muscle development and digestive health
Crude Protein (Min.) 22%
Crude Fat (Min.) 11%
Crude Fibre (Max.) 3.5%
Moisture (Max.) 11%
Calcium (Min.) 1%
Phosphorus (Min.) 0.8%
Calorie Content 3,539 kcal/kg (Calculated ME)
Special Features Natural fruit flavors, prebiotic fibre, Omega fatty acids and balanced vitamins & minerals
Artificial Colors/Flavors None
Preservatives No artificial preservatives
Storage Store in a sealed container in a cool, dry place after opening

Is 2 mm better for my bird than the 4 mm or Stick version?

Not necessarily “better”—the size needs to match the bird.

For a cockatiel, lovebird or small conure, the 2 mm granules are the format HARI specifically recommends. Larger parrots may be more comfortable with 4 mm granules, 8 mm rounds or sticks depending on species.

Choosing the correct size can also reduce food wastage. Owners on bird forums have reported that some smaller parrots handle 2 mm pellets more easily and create less waste than larger pieces.

Is High Performance suitable for a normal adult cockatiel or lovebird?

It can be, but High Performance is not simply the “better” version of Lifetime.

HARI positions High Performance for weaning, fledgling, breeding and higher-energy situations, whereas Lifetime is designed for maintenance in companion birds that are not moulting or experiencing other significant stress.

For a healthy adult cockatiel or lovebird with ordinary activity levels, Tropican Lifetime 2 mm may be the more appropriate maintenance formula. High Performance makes more sense when the bird has increased nutritional demands.

Is the 2 mm formula suitable for a weaning or fledgling bird?

Yes. Weaning and fledgling birds are among the main groups for which HARI recommends High Performance.

However, very young chicks that are still dependent on hand-feeding require an appropriate hand-feeding formula. High Performance is more relevant as the bird progresses into weaning and independent eating.

Can High Performance be used during breeding and moulting?

Yes. HARI specifically recommends High Performance for breeding birds, and its higher nutrient profile is intended for birds with increased nutritional requirements. The formula provides balanced calcium and vitamin D, along with amino acids important for feather and muscle development.

For a bird with a medical problem, chronic moulting or reproductive complications, dietary changes should be discussed with an avian veterinarian.

Does my bird need additional vitamin supplements with Tropican High Performance?

Generally, no. HARI incorporates vitamins and minerals into the formula and states that a vitamin supplement is not needed when Tropican is fed as intended.

Fresh vegetables, greens and other suitable foods can still be offered for dietary variety and enrichment. Avoid adding supplements unnecessarily, particularly fat-soluble vitamins, unless recommended by an avian veterinarian.

My bird refuses the pellets. What should I do?

This is very common when changing a parrot's diet and doesn't necessarily mean the food is unsuitable.

Birds can be strongly attached to the appearance, smell and texture of their familiar food. Owner discussions show that acceptance varies considerably—some birds readily eat Tropican, while others initially reject it.

Try a gradual transition and, where appropriate, experiment with presentation. Do not allow a bird to stop eating simply to force acceptance of a new pellet.

How should I store Tropican High Performance 2 mm in India?

Once opened, HARI recommends storing the food in a sealed container in a cool, dry place.

This deserves extra attention in India because heat and humidity can affect the freshness of bird food. Keep the container away from direct sunlight, moisture and kitchen heat, and don't leave the bag loosely open.
